Activities :

-The removal of unwanted elements through the production of slag is an integral function of current steelmaking practices.  Heckett Multiserv Bahna’s extensive experience in the efficient removal, handling and processing of slag allows steelmakers to focus on their core metal production processes. We select the most appropriate methods and equipment to meet the client's requirements through the application of our global best practice.

-Heckett Multiserv Bahna operates over 10 specialized carriers transporting molten slag in pots 25m3.  Heckett Multiserv Bahna ensures all slag handling operations are safe and efficient.  All hot work equipment owned and operated by Heckett Multiserv Bahna is fitted with a liquid-based fire suppression system which helps to protect the operator from heat and fumes if a fire occurs. 

-Maximizing the working life of slag pots is becoming increasingly important.  Slag pots are cycled to optimize thermal loading.  Cold graded slag is added and pots are sprayed with special agents to help prevent stickers and reduce the need for knocking.

-Liquid slag is tipped into purpose designed slag pits and cooled under carefully controlled conditions.  Slag is then processed to recover the metallic content for re-use by the client.  De-metallised slag is weathered, crushed and screened into various sized products for sale by Heckett Multiserv Bahna or the client.

-Developments in slag handling include rapid cooling, granulation and atomization of slag, allowing the production of higher value products, and the stabilization of falling stainless steel slag to reduce environmental issues.
